So, no init system or anything? Your terminal probably hasn't been set up. This is a surprisingly tricky bit of "magic" done with a special syscall which we're for the most part happy to let some linux distribution do for us.

One workaround for it, funny enough, could be ssh-ing into your device. A virtual terminal should be close enough.

I was sure that busybox had a utility for it, and their faq turns out to have that and a better explanation what it does:

Quote:
"Why do I keep getting "sh: can't access tty; job control turned off" errors? Why doesn't Control-C work within my shell?"

Job control will be turned off since your shell can not obtain a controlling terminal. This typically happens when you run your shell on /dev/console. The kernel will not provide a controlling terminal on the /dev/console device. You should run your shell on a normal tty such as tty1 or ttyS0 and everything will work.

Example: you booted into your machine with init=/bin/sh and got "sh: can't access tty" error because sh has its stdio opened to /dev/console. You want to reopen stdio to, say, /dev/tty1 and thus acquire a controlling tty.

Code:
    # Let's try this:
    exec </dev/tty1 >/dev/tty1 2>&1
    # No, doesn't work: even if opening /dev/tty1 gave sh the ctty,
    # sh wouldn't know it - it checks for ctty just once at startup.

    # Let's try re-execing sh:
    exec </dev/tty1 >/dev/tty1 2>&1
    exec sh
    # Got "sh: can't access tty" again. Why?
    # The reason is somewhat obscure: kernel starts process with PID=1
    # (in this case, shell) with SID=0 and PGID=0, not with SID=1 and PGID=1
    # as you'd expect. IOW: our sh is not a session leader, and therefore
    # cannot acquire ctty by opening /dev/tty1 (or any other tty).

    # Let's try making us a session leader:
    exec setsid sh
    exec </dev/tty1 >/dev/tty1 2>&1
    exec sh
    # Yes, this worked!

    # This can be combined into one command,
    # but need to be careful and perform these operations
    # in the correct order:
    # 1. make ourself session leader,
    # 2. open /dev/tty1 and thus acquire a ctty,
    # 3. re-execute the shell, allowing it to notice that it has a ctty:
    exec setsid sh -c 'exec sh </dev/tty1 >/dev/tty1 2>&1'

AMIXER(1)						      General Commands Manual							 AMIXER(1)

NAME
amixer - command-line mixer for ALSA soundcard driver SYNOPSIS
amixer [-option] [cmd] DESCRIPTION
amixer allows command-line control of the mixer for the ALSA soundcard driver. amixer supports multiple soundcards. amixer with no arguments will display the current mixer settings for the default soundcard and device. This is a good way to see a list of the simple mixer controls you can use. COMMANDS
help Shows syntax. info Shows the information about a mixer device. scontrols Shows a complete list of simple mixer controls. scontents Shows a complete list of simple mixer controls with their contents. set or sset <SCONTROL> <PARAMETER> ... Sets the simple mixer control contents. The parameter can be the volume either as a percentage from 0% to 100% with % suffix, a dB gain with dB suffix (like -12.5dB), or an exact hardware value. The dB gain can be used only for the mixer elements with available dB information. When plus(+) or minus(-) letter is appended after volume value, the volume is incremented or decremented from the current value, respectively. The parameters cap, nocap, mute, unmute, toggle are used to change capture (recording) and muting for the group specified. The optional modifiers can be put as extra parameters to specify the stream direction or channels to apply. The modifiers playback and capture specify the stream, and the modifiers front, rear, center, woofer are used to specify channels to be changed. A simple mixer control must be specified. Only one device can be controlled at a time. get or sget <SCONTROL> Shows the simple mixer control contents. A simple mixer control must be specified. Only one device can be controlled at a time. controls Shows a complete list of card controls. contents Shows a complete list of card controls with their contents. cset <CONTROL> <PARAMETER> ... Sets the card control contents. The identifier has these components: iface, name, index, device, subdevice, numid. The next argument specifies the value of control. cget <CONTROL> Shows the card control contents. The identifier has same syntax as for the cset command. OPTIONS
-c card Select the card number to control. The device name created from this parameter has syntax 'hw:N' where N is specified card number. -D device Select the device name to control. The default control name is 'default'. -s | --stdin Read from stdin and execute the command on each line sequentially. When this option is given, the command in command-line arguments is ignored. Only sset and cset are accepted. Other commands are ignored. The commands to unmatched ids are ignored without errors too. -h Help: show syntax. -q Quiet mode. Do not show results of changes. -R Use the raw value for evaluating the percentage representation. This is the default mode. -M Use the mapped volume for evaluating the percentage representation like alsamixer, to be more natural for human ear. EXAMPLES
amixer -c 1 sset Line,0 80%,40% unmute cap will set the second soundcard's left line input volume to 80% and right line input to 40%, unmute it, and select it as a source for capture (recording). amixer -c 1 -- sset Master playback -20dB will set the master volume of the second card to -20dB. If the master has multiple channels, all channels are set to the same value. amixer -c 1 set PCM 2dB+ will increase the PCM volume of the second card with 2dB. When both playback and capture volumes exist, this is applied to both volumes. amixer -c 2 cset iface=MIXER,name='Line Playback Volume",index=1 40% will set the third soundcard's second line playback volume(s) to 40% amixer -c 2 cset numid=34 40% will set the 34th soundcard element to 40% SEE ALSO
